Output 51025953c0b3df9a55961475f9ead71d47ee4fc28943685b2effa3ffe720a4f4:4

value
144104158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a981a600db719170cc08afcebdefdf52a9f12d46 OP_EQUAL
address
MPMRjyu2JcUkjXeUwXLz8u3tK3jM7FSaW9
transaction
51025953c0b3df9a55961475f9ead71d47ee4fc28943685b2effa3ffe720a4f4
spent
true